How much do part time electrical design j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time electrical design in Charleston, SC is $94,585.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$77,200.00 and $108,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a part time electrical design?

A Part-Time Electrical Design job involves creating and developing electrical systems, schematics, and layouts for various projects while working fewer hours than a full-time position. Responsibilities may include circuit design, PCB layout, wiring diagrams, and ensuring compliance with industry standards. These roles are often found in industries like manufacturing, construction, or product development. Part-time positions offer flexibility and can be suitable for freelancers, students, or professionals looking for reduced work hours.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ed for part time electrical design?

A strong background in electrical engineering principles, proficiency in circuit design, and experience with drafting tools or CAD software are essential for a Part Time Electrical Design role. Familiarity with industry-standard tools such as AutoCAD, MATLAB, or EAGLE, and relevant certifications (like EIT or PE) are often highly valued. Excellent teamwork, attention to detail, and effective time management are key soft skills that help candidates excel. These competencies ensure the production of accurate and innovative electrical designs while meeting project deadlines and collaborating effectively with colleagues.

What do part time electrical design professionals do?

As a Part Time Electrical Design professional, you will typically assist with designing electrical systems, preparing technical drawings, and collaborating on project specifications under the guidance of senior engineers. Day-to-day responsibilities include updating schematics, performing calculations, reviewing component choices, and participating in design meetings or project reviews. You may also be asked to troubleshoot design issues, support documentation efforts, and coordinate with other departments such as mechanical or software teams. The part-time structure often means a flexible schedule, but it is important to communicate consistently with your team to ensure project milestones are met.

Job description

Why You'll Love Being a Brownswood Team Member:
You are a practical, hands-on problem-solver who enjoys repairing, building, and keeping a busy property running smoothly. In this part-time role, you will support general maintenance and improvement projects across Brownswood's campus. Each day may bring a different challenge, from repairing a gate or tree line to completing basic wiring, woodworking, property upkeep, or light technology support.
Brownswood Nursery is Charleston's largest nursery and design-build firm. We offer a complete line of services from growing to landscape design and installation to maintenance. We have been inspiring people to grow since 1978 and strongly believe in investing in the professional growth of each member of our team. This role is ideal for a dependable handyman who values variety, teamwork, and practical problem-solving.
What We Offer:
  • A flexible part-time schedule of approximately 20 hours per week
  • A supportive, fast-paced, and team-oriented work environment
  • Training and certification opportunities (i.e. SC CNP, SC CLP)
  • Employee discount
  • Opportunities to expand skills and responsibilities

What You Will Do:
  • Complete general handyman, repair, and maintenance projects throughout the nursery
  • Perform basic carpentry, including repairs to gates, fencing, shelving, work areas, and other property features
  • Assist with basic electrical and wiring tasks within your experience, such as replacing fixtures, organizing cables, and supporting equipment installations
  • Repair and maintain tree lines, greenhouse components, shade cloth, doors, fixtures, and other facility or property features
  • Handle minor plumbing, painting, hardware installation, and general facility upkeep
  • Provide light IT support, including basic hardware setup, cable organization, mounting equipment, and physical installations
  • Assist with irrigation troubleshooting, groundskeeping, storm and freeze preparation, severe-weather response, and cleanup
  • Perform basic maintenance and minor repairs on golf carts, utility vehicles, tools, and landscaping equipment as needed
  • Assist with limited small-engine troubleshooting and routine equipment maintenance when within your experience
  • Maintain simple service records, organize tools and supplies, keep work areas clean and safe, and communicate repair priorities to the Facilities Manager

What We Are Looking For:
  • A dependable, self-starting individual with practical handyman skills and strong problem-solving ability
  • Experience in facilities maintenance, construction, carpentry, property maintenance, landscaping, or a related trade preferred, but not required
  • Working knowledge of hand and power tools, woodworking, basic electrical and wiring, plumbing, irrigation, or general property repair
  • Comfort providing light IT and equipment support and learning unfamiliar systems when needed
  • A safety-minded approach and the ability to work independently while supporting multiple departments
  • Strong organization, communication, follow-through, and attention to detail
  • Ability to work outdoors in changing weather and lift and carry up to 50 pounds
  • A valid driver's license and acceptable driving record preferred
  • Honesty, diligence, flexibility, and a strong work ethic
